The Problem Status records whether the indicated problem is active, inactive, or resolved.
THIS TEMPLATE HAS BEEN DEPRECATED IN C-CDA R2 AND MAY BE DELETED FROM A FUTURE RELEASE
OF THIS IMPLEMENTATION GUIDE. USE OF THIS TEMPLATE IS NOT RECOMMENDED. *Reason for
deprecation*: Per the explanation in Volume 1, Section 3.2 "Determining a Clinical
Statement's Status",
the status of a problem is determined based on attributes of the Problem Observation.
